The show's creators, Raj & DK, have been vocal about their creative decision. They insisted on keeping lengthy sequences in Tamil to maintain the story's authenticity. For a purely Tamil-speaking audience, reading Hindi subtitles for Tamil dialogues seemed counter-intuitive, which amplified the demand for a proper Tamil dub. Dubbing the series into Tamil expanded its accessibility considerably. Many viewers prefer watching content in their native language for ease of comprehension and emotional connection. The Tamil dub allowed non-Hindi speakers — including older family members and viewers less comfortable with subtitles — to engage fully with complex plotlines, subtle dialogue, and character dynamics without the friction of reading text. Consequently, the show’s reach widened beyond its initial geographic and linguistic boundaries, contributing to pan-Indian conversations about its themes.

Directing duo Raj & DK managed to blend high-octane action with domestic drama seamlessly. The cinematography in the Chennai sequences is gritty and realistic, and the long-take action sequences are a masterclass in choreography. The Family Man , created by Raj & DK, took the Indian OTT space by storm with its debut season on Amazon Prime Video. Featuring a crucial, central storyline based in Chennai and introducing the legendary Samantha Akkineni in a fierce role, the Tamil dubbed version allowed for an immersive experience, capturing the authentic nuances of the show's South Indian setting.
